Monday, Jan. 25, 2021

IOC President Thomas Bach and local organizers are pushing back against reports that the postponed Tokyo Olympics will be canceled.

Now set to open July 23, the Tokyo Games were postponed 10 months ago at the outbreak of the coronavirus pandemic, and now the event appears threatened again...

MySHOOT Company Profiles